LAHORE: The Lahore High Court (LHC) allowed restaurants to remain open from Sehri to Iftar.

Justice Shahid Karim of the Lahore High Court issued a written order of the last hearing on the petitions filed about anti-smog measures.

In the written order, the court directed the school children to conduct one day practical in a week related to environment and asked that a report on the curriculum should be submitted in the next hearing.

According to the order, in the report of the public prosecutor, it has been stated that the electricity of all the tire burning units has been disconnected.

The court further said in its order that instructions have been issued to prevent LESCO (Lahore Electric Supply Company) officials from cutting trees, LESCO should first inform PHA if any tree is to be cut.

Besides, the court has allowed the restaurants to remain open from Iftar to Sehri.
